Transaction 61f65e61beadd5605d7c30cc6cb17ce7cf65dca4bd0e5bb5d92bb0ffd1a27c6d
1 Input
1 Output
-
61f65e61beadd5605d7c30cc6cb17ce7cf65dca4bd0e5bb5d92bb0ffd1a27c6d:0
- value
- 18398764
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d5d2be1b325ceabe5872606745c8a405f6be526 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DtTtiFvJ9aKKohAoGtau7x847Hhs1qqv5